Wood rot is fungal decay, not simple aging. A fungus feeds on the cellulose in wood, and it needs sustained moisture to establish itself and keep growing. It starts wherever water reaches wood repeatedly without drying out, a failed seal, a clogged gutter, a grading issue, anything that keeps a piece of wood consistently damp long enough for decay to take hold.

The most reliable check is the Poke Test: press a flathead screwdriver into the wood. Solid wood resists. Decayed wood gives way easily, often sinking a quarter inch or more. Look for discoloration, a cube-like cracking pattern, or a musty smell, especially at windowsills, deck boards, and siding near ground level.

Wood rot and mold often show up together but aren't the same thing. Mold grows on the surface and is mainly an air-quality concern. Wood rot consumes the wood itself and compromises its structural integrity.

It depends entirely on the extent, which isn't something you can judge by eye. A documented moisture-meter reading tells you whether the affected wood is repairable with an epoxy consolidant or needs replacing. Early findings are almost always repairable. The only way to know for certain is an actual reading, not a guess.

Vancouver's roughly six-month wet season, mild temperatures that don't freeze decay dormant the way colder climates do, and, in many neighbourhoods, mature tree canopy that keeps siding and trim shaded and slow to dry, combine to make this a persistent issue here in a way it isn't everywhere in Canada.

It depends on how far the decay has progressed, and that's decided by a moisture-meter reading, not a visual guess. If sound wood remains, epoxy consolidation restores structural integrity. If decay has compromised the wood beyond that point, replacement is the honest answer. We tell you which one applies to your specific finding, in writing.

No. Painting over active rot traps moisture in rather than letting it escape, and it hides the wood's condition from view, making it harder to track whether the problem is getting worse. It's a common, well-intentioned mistake, not a fix.

Moisture control is the only thing that actually halts fungal activity. While arranging a proper repair, address any active leak source immediately, improve airflow to the area, and keep it as dry as possible. This buys time, it doesn't replace finding and fixing the actual cause.

Windowsills, brickmold, deck boards and ledgers, siding near ground level, fascia and soffits, and door thresholds, anywhere wood sits in repeated contact with water without a clear way to dry out.

Rot doesn't stay small. It's an active, living fungus that keeps consuming wood as long as moisture is present, and it can even go dormant when dry and reactivate once it's wet again. A small, contained finding today is the cheapest and simplest stage to address it.
